Replacing cedar shingles addresses several common issues that can compromise a roof’s integrity. Over time, cedar shingles may experience warping, cracking, or rotting due to exposure to moisture, sunlight, and temperature fluctuations. These problems can lead to leaks, reduced insulation, and increased vulnerability to pests. Cedar shingle replacement helps eliminate these concerns by removing deteriorated materials and installing new shingles that enhance the roof’s resistance to weather damage, ultimately extending its lifespan.

Cost Range - Cedar shingle replacement typically costs between $8,000 and $20,000 for an average-sized roof. Factors such as roof size and shingle quality can influence the total price.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ific project details.
Material Expenses - The cost of cedar shingles themselves generally falls between $4 and $8 per square foot. Higher-grade shingles or custom styles may increase material costs, impacting the overall project budget.
Labor Costs - Labor for cedar shingle replacement usually ranges from $3,000 to $7,000 depending on roof complexity and local rates. Professional installation ensures proper fitting and durability of the shingles.
Additional Fees - Extra costs may include roof removal, disposal, and repairs, which can add $1,000 to $3,000 or more. Pros can assess the specific needs of each project to provide accurate estimates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How often should cedar shingles be replaced? The replacement frequency for cedar shingles depends on factors like climate, maintenance, and aging, but typically they may need replacement every 20 to 30 years. A local professional can assess the condition of existing shingles to determine if replacement is necessary.
What signs indicate the need for cedar shingle replacement? Visible signs such as extensive cracking, curling, mold, or significant warping suggest that cedar shingles may require replacement. An inspection by a local contractor can help identify underlying issues.
Are cedar shingles recyclable or environmentally friendly? Cedar shingles are a natural material and can often be recycled or repurposed, making them an environmentally friendly choice when replaced. Local service providers can advise on proper disposal or recycling options.
Can cedar shingles be repaired instead of replaced? Minor damage to cedar shingles can sometimes be repaired, but extensive deterioration usually necessitates full replacement. A local expert can evaluate the extent of damage to recommend the best solution.
